Compatibility With Fan Types

Choosing a fan speed controller that matches your greenhouse fan’s motor type is vital for reliable operation and longevity. It’s important to verify the controller is compatible with resistive or inductive loads, as improper matching can cause malfunction or damage. Confirm that the controller supports your fan’s voltage and current ratings to prevent overloads. For larger or high-power fans, validate it can handle the start-up and running wattage to avoid issues during operation. Additionally, check if the controller’s connectors, like 3-pin or 4-pin plugs, match your fan’s plug type. The control method—whether analog, PWM, or digital—should also align with your fan’s design to guarantee optimal performance. Proper compatibility ensures smooth, efficient, and durable operation of your greenhouse ventilation system.

Power Supply Compatibility

Making certain your fan speed controller matches your greenhouse’s power supply is crucial for safe and reliable operation. First, check that the controller’s voltage rating aligns with your system, typically 110V or 220V. Next, verify that its maximum current capacity exceeds the total amperage draw of all connected fans to prevent overloads. It’s also important to confirm compatibility with resistive or inductive loads, as some controllers are designed specifically for certain types. Additionally, ensure the power plug and outlet type match your existing electrical setup for secure connections. If your greenhouse operates with different power standards or supplies, consider whether the controller supports dual or variable voltage inputs. Proper compatibility helps avoid electrical issues and ensures your ventilation system runs smoothly.

Environmental Durability

Since greenhouse environments can be harsh with frequent moisture, temperature swings, and dust, selecting a fan speed controller built to withstand these conditions is indispensable. Look for controllers with rugged, corrosion-resistant shells made of high-quality ABS plastic or metal, which boost durability. High IP ratings like IP65 or higher are critical, as they indicate resistance to dust and water ingress, ideal for outdoor or humid settings. Additionally, controllers with flame-retardant and weatherproof materials perform better over time. Protection features such as overload, short-circuit, and surge protection are essential to prevent damage caused by electrical surges or moisture exposure. Choosing a durable controller ensures reliable operation and longevity, even in the most challenging greenhouse conditions.
